Professor Bowen had always wanted to reassemble the graduate players for a Quidditch match. She knew it would be a fantastic game and that it would be a good experience for the current players to watch a game played by more experienced players. So she was pleased that some of the adults had agreed to play her favorite game.

Since there were only two houses with graduates, it would be like old times. It appeared as if some of the Feu and Nuage students had chosen a house to support. It tickled her to see crimson and purple mingled in with emerald and blue.

"Welcome to the first ever graduate Quidditch match!" Professor Bowen announced to the audience after all the players had gathered on the field. "I am glad to welcome our previous players and announcers back! Please make them feel at home, as the castle was their home first."

Bowen turned to the players and looked at them with a smile. "Most of you have heard my spiel for so many years. I don't think I need to say it again to you all. I just want to say thank you so much for coming back to play and I hope you all enjoy your time here at the castle. Sylvian, Green, shake hands."

Professor Bowen smiled up at the graduates as they took their positions in the sky. She blew her whistle and released the game balls.

Linette was very excited for this reunion match.  There was only one little disappointment but she was not going to let that get in her way of enjoying her favourite position of her old Beauxbatons days.  She hoped that one day there would be another reunion in the future when her daughter will finally be a student.  Preferably a Cerisier student.

She grinned as she waited for Professor Bowen to give her usual spiel and was only slightly disappointed her old flying instructor didn't do just that.  Well they were all adults now so that may have made the difference.  

And finally the match began. "Hello students and my fellow graduates both new and old.  Welcome to this wonderful day of a match between two relatively good teams. I couldn't say great. There's a player or two missing from the old line-up.  Today we have leading the teams the Silver Swan who must have taken over after my favourite Book Sniffer graduated along with me and a few others.  The other team captain being some bloke called Green. Oops. I mean Ryan Green.  You know that Cerisier won my last year at Beauxbatons Green?  Can you repeat that winning performance? No pressure.

"For those of you who don't know me or my fellow commentator, I am Linette Puchard and the gentleman beside me is Caleb Miller.  We will be guiding you through this match of the old guard and nostalgia. Sure to be entertainment for all.  Just like old times." What she kept quiet about was her disappointment of Osmund and Christian both piking.  Well maybe it was a good thing the latter wasn't here.  She wasn't quite sure how she'd take him leading the Cerisier graduates instead of the player who must be too young to have played when she'd been announcing back in the old days.

Marie-Laure loved Quidditch and had at one time half-considered playing professionally. Instead she'd gone with the more stable and possibly more dangerous career of an auror. Thus when invited to play in a reunion match she hadn't hesitated to agree. What she hadn't expected was to be named as captain of the reunion team or have the two announcers who had both been announcing when she'd played back in the announcing booth again. One she was more than happy to have there. The other ... well she would reserve judgement due to the fact it'd been many years since the last time they'd been on this pitch at the same time. None of the ones close to her age were teenagers anymore. The others she couldn't be sure. They looked as thought they were barely out of Beauxbatons.

She shook hands with one of those younger players, captain of the graduated Cerisier team. That made her feel really old but the feelings of age were pushed aside the moment she was in the air and heard the first voice of the announcers floating across the pitch. Filter them out, she told herself. Not even Caleb's voice would be welcome whilst Marie-Laure and her team played against their old rivals.
